Is TryAgent production-ready?
Legit.Show scores TryAgent 72 out of 100 — the simple average of its 7 measured frames. Legit.Show ran its deterministic 7-Frame production-readiness benchmark on TryAgent (public-surface assessment), measured from the public surface with no LLM in the scoring path. Its strongest frame is Accessibility; its weakest is Security. Every frame it averages is published with its evidence on the Legit.Show listing.
The 7 Frames
- Performance — 76/100
- Accessibility — 100/100
- Security — 25/100
- Privacy — 75/100
- Reliability — 100/100
- Standards — 92/100
- Discoverability — 35/100
What we measured
- No Content-Security-Policy and no HSTS.
- Served over HTTPS with a valid certificate.
- Real Lighthouse performance run — 401 ms to first byte.
- Returns a proper 404 for unknown routes.
- 3 of 3 sampled routes reachable.
- Has a reachable privacy policy.
- Sets cookies / loads scripts with no consent prompt.
